Computing Needs: Tiered System

Pace University categorizes users into two tiers based on their computing needs:

Tier 1 Users

These are standard users whose daily tasks require basic system applications with low system requirements. Examples of applications used by Tier 1 users include:

  •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ook, Publisher, Access, etc.)
  • Microsoft Visio and Microsoft Project
  • Web-based applications
  • Adobe Acrobat Pro
  • Panopto
  • SPSS and SAS (basic analysis)
  • Zoom
  • Creative Cloud (Photoshop, etc. - small basic projects)

Tier 2 Users

These users require advanced system applications with specific system requirements beyond those of Tier 1 models.

IT Support

Pace ITS staff provides different levels of support for various software, systems, and applications:

  • Full Support (FS): Pace ITS staff provides full support.
  • Limited Support (LS): Pace ITS staff will make a concerted effort to provide assistance or offer alternative resources if applicable. Software, systems, or applications that are not listed below are considered unsupported applications. ITS will make a concerted effort to provide assistance for unsupported applications.

Pace Web-Based Systems Compatibility

For internal Pace web-based systems, the latest versions of Mozilla Firefox or Google Chrome are recommended. Older and unlisted web browser versions are not currently supported.
